| # Configuring a build directory |
| |
| Often you want to change the settings of your build after it has been |
| generated. For example you might want to change from a debug build |
| into a release build, set custom compiler flags, change the build |
| options provided in your `meson.options` file and so on. |
| |
| The main tool for this is the `meson configure` command. |
| |
| You invoke `meson configure` by giving it the location of your build |
| dir. If omitted, the current working directory is used instead. Here's |
| a sample output for a simple project. |
| |

| These are all the options available for the current project arranged |
| into related groups. The first column in every field is the name of |
| the option. To set an option you use the `-D` option. For example, |
| changing the installation prefix from `/usr/local` to `/tmp/testroot` |
| you would issue the following command. |
| |
| meson configure -Dprefix=/tmp/testroot |
| |
| Then you would run your build command (usually `meson compile`), which |
| would cause Meson to detect that the build setup has changed and do |
| all the work required to bring your build tree up to date. |
| |
| Since 0.50.0, it is also possible to get a list of all build options |
| by invoking [`meson configure`](Commands.md#configure) with the |
| project source directory or the path to the root `meson.build`. In |
| this case, Meson will print the default values of all options similar |
| to the example output from above. |
